Mary Pat Clarke Death, Obituary Baltimore, Maryland – Mary Pat Clarke, a prominent Baltimore politician known for her dedicated public service and commitment to Baltimore’s communities, passed away on November 10, 2024, at the age of 83. Clarke, who made history as the first woman elected President of the Baltimore City Council, leaves behind a profound legacy spanning more than three decades of civic engagement and transformative leadership. Born in Providence, Rhode Island, on June 22, 1941, Clarke was a dedicated advocate who spent the majority of her career championing the causes of Baltimore’s underrepresented communities. Jo Jo Dullard Death, Obituary – A man has been arrested on suspicion of the murder of Josephine “Jo Jo” Dullard, who disappeared nearly 29 years ago, on November 9, 1995. Gardaí confirmed the arrest on Saturday, which marked the anniversary of her disappearance. The suspect, a man in his 50s, is currently being detained at a Garda station in County Kildare under the provisions of the Criminal Justice Act, 1984.
